21xrx.com
2024-11-22 05:46:52 Friday
登录
文章检索 我的文章 写文章
使用Node.js搭建服务器并写入数据
2023-07-07 08:07:44 深夜i     --     --
Node js 服务器 数据 搭建 写入

Node.js是一个非常流行的服务器端JavaScript运行环境。它可以帮助我们快速地搭建一个服务器,并为客户端提供服务。在本文中,我们将介绍如何使用Node.js搭建服务器,并向服务器写入数据。

首先,我们需要确保已经安装了Node.js。如果没有安装,请前往 Node.js官网 下载并安装。安装完成后,我们将从以下内容开始构建服务器。

首先,我们需要创建一个项目文件夹。在这个文件夹中,我们将创建一个名为 server.js 的文件。这是我们的服务器程序的核心文件。

接下来,我们将使用以下代码创建一个简单的服务器:


// 引入 http 模块

const http = require('http');

// 创建一个服务器,使用一个回调函数去接收请求

const server = http.createServer((req, res) => {

 res.end('Hello World!');

});

// 启动服务器,监听 8080 端口

server.listen(8080, () => {

 console.log('服务器已经启动,正在监听 8080 端口。');

});

我们的服务器现在会接收来自客户端的请求,并在客户端页面上输出“Hello World!”

现在,我们想让服务器向一个文本文件中写入数据。我们可以使用 Node.js 自带的 fs 模块来完成这个操作。我们可以使用以下代码向一个名为 data.txt 的文件中写入数据:


// 引入 fs 模块

const fs = require('fs');

// 向文件中写入数据

fs.writeFile('data.txt', 'Hello World!', () => {

 console.log('数据已成功写入文件!');

});

现在,每次客户端访问服务器时,服务器都会向 data.txt 文件写入一条数据。我们可以使用这种方式来捕捉来自客户端的数据请求,以便更好地记录数据。

总之,使用 Node.js 搭建服务器并向服务器写入数据是一项强大的技能。我们可以使用这些技能来开发各种服务,并跟踪请求的数据和行为。希望这篇文章对你有所帮助!

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复